Compensation for Harrogate pensioner after being hit by a vehicle whilst crossing the road
Our client, a pensioner from Harrogate, sustained a serious fracture of the right knee and required a knee replacement after being hit by a vehicle when crossing the road. He was struck by a Ford Transit van which had turned out of a minor road onto the road which he was crossing.
In addition to the injuries sustained, there were complications with his recovery and he developed an infection at the site of the knee replacement, requiring further surgery. As a consequence of this, our client now has reduced mobility and has also developed urological symptoms following his surgery.
Cathryn Godfrey, from our Serious Injury team in Leeds represented the client on behalf of Irwin Mitchell and commented, “the circumstances of this accident are a reminder of the need for drivers to take care and be vigilant when exiting from minor roads whereby visibility may be reduced.
Prior to the accident our client was independent and self sufficient. The long term consequences of this accident will therefore have an impact on his day to day activities, and the compensation received will go toward future care and treatment. It will also fund the assistance he now requires with household tasks due to the ongoing symptoms developed as a result of the injuries sustained.”
